After talks with Chinese President Xi Jingping on Saturday, US President Donald Trump said that he will allow Huawei to buy products from US suppliers.

Trump said the news at a press conference following the Group of 20 summit in Osaka, Japan.

Trump was quoted saying "US companies can sell their equipment to Huawei. We’re talking about equipment where there’s no great national security problem with it."

This comes after US companies resumed business with the Chinese giant along with assurance by Huawei that customers will receive timely Android updates.

Just last month, the US's Commerce Department blacklisted Huawei, a move that could potentially slow down the speedy growth of the company worldwide.

Trump's administration accused the global Chinese tech company of spying. Huawei denied the accusation.

The US government also failed to present any proof showing that Huawei is a threat to its national security.

But, it still resulted in a ban forbidding American companies to sell their products and solutions to Huawei. It included operating systems, chipsets, and other components required to make a phone or a PC.

I said that’s O.K., that we will keep selling that product, these are American companies that make these products. That's very complex, by the way, Trump said. I've agreed to allow them to continue to sell that product so that American companies will continue.

However, the ban resulted in unforeseen damage to American companies to relied on Huawei as a customer. To recall, Huawei purchased USD 11 billion in American goods in 2018.

But since Trump softens its stance against Huawei, the US government is expected to officially allow the company from buying to US suppliers soon.

We are just unsure yet if this means that Trump will also allow Huawei to sell its goods to the US.

Still, it is a fascinating development revolving the "now-paused" US-China trade war.
